Cropped, then blew it up to 8000x5000 and vexeled in Paint Tool SAI (about eight hours over two days); it was also my first time using that program. No changes to the original art. I cut the image into four parts before vexeling because of lag, and then rejoined them and then filled in the shading. Colors were then done in Adobe Photoshop Elements 4.0; I referenced a couple different official scans for these. I used a small amount of gradient but it's basically just solid color because the shadows are already so dark.
I decided to keep the background pale for a couple of reasons, the first being that I lost a bunch of revisions so I can only go back so many steps. Second, the starkness of the shadows and focus on clean lines seemed to look better on pale than a more detailed background. Last, I wanted the bright red flower petals to stand out.
